Here is a look at what has been on my mind lately... dining rooms! I love the look you get when you mix design styles! This dining room mixes farmhouse with modern and I love it - not to mention I am mixing some of my favorite colors for a fresh look!
SOURCE LIST:
2. Trellis linen drum shade - Shades of Light
3. Edmund Dining Table - Home Decorators
4. Industrial Style Dining Chair - Home Decorators
5. Flat-weave area rug - Zinc Door
6. Recycled glass vases - West Elm
7. Appetizer plates - Target
8. Black Clay Dinnerware - CB2
9. Garden Napkin Set - West Elm
10. Porcelain Pitcher - Target
